Degrees in Automation
Students interested in engineering and working with high-tech equipment may want to study automation. Through a variety of classes, students can learn how to operate, fix and maintain automated equipment of electromechanical systems and industrial electronics.
The USA remains the world’s most popular destination for international students. Universities in the US dominate the world rankings and the country also offers a wide variety of exciting study locations. State university systems are partially subsidized by state governments, and may have many campuses spread around the state, with hundreds of thousands of students.
